Swedish Hill South First, Austin

Swedish Hill South First is a stylish South Austin cafΓ© where fresh pastries, polished brunch plates, and relaxed neighborhood energy create one of the city's best slower-paced dining experiences.

Set along South 1st Street just south of Elizabeth Street CafΓ© and minutes from Bouldin Creek and South Congress, this airy cafΓ© surrounds guests with natural light, espresso aromas, shaded patio seating, and locals gathering for coffee meetings, brunch dates, and long easy mornings that slowly drift into the afternoon. Swedish Hill South First reflects Austin's growing love for hybrid cafΓ© spaces that function equally well as bakeries, brunch spots, coffee shops, and neighborhood gathering places.

Pastries and cafΓ© dining sit at the center of the experience here. Croissants, breads, breakfast plates, sandwiches, and espresso drinks create a menu designed for lingering. The South 1st location shapes the atmosphere. Surrounded by boutiques, cafΓ©s, cocktail bars, and walkable South Austin neighborhoods, the restaurant feels woven directly into one of the city's most relaxed and social corridors.
